๐ Definition of Real-World Services
Real-world services are the essential activities and jobs that people do to help others in their daily lives. These services make our communities function smoothly and provide us with the things we need.
๐๏ธ History and Background
The need for services has existed since the earliest human societies. As communities grew, people specialized in different tasks. Bartering, or trading goods and services, was an early form of exchange. Over time, money became the primary way to pay for these essential services. From ancient artisans to modern-day professionals, services have always been the backbone of civilization.

๐ Real-World Examples of Services
๐ฉโโ๏ธ Healthcare Services
- ๐ฉบ Doctors: Provide medical care and treatment.
- ๐ฅ Nurses: Assist doctors and care for patients.
- ๐ Paramedics: Respond to emergencies and provide first aid.
๐ Emergency Services
- ๐ฅ Firefighters: Extinguish fires and rescue people.
- ๐ฎ Police Officers: Maintain law and order, protect citizens.
- ๐จ Emergency Medical Technicians (EMTs): Provide medical care in emergencies.
๐ Transportation Services
- ๐ Bus Drivers: Transport people to different locations.
- ๐ Taxi Drivers: Provide individual transportation services.
- โ๏ธ Pilots: Fly airplanes to transport people and goods.
๐ Education Services
- ๐จโ๐ซ Teachers: Educate students in various subjects.
- ๐ Librarians: Help people find information and resources.
- ๐ฉโ๐ Tutors: Provide individual academic support.
๐ Retail Services
- ๐๏ธ Cashiers: Process payments and assist customers.
- ๐ฆ Stock Clerks: Organize and stock merchandise.
- ๐ค Sales Associates: Help customers find products and make purchases.
๐ฝ๏ธ Food Services
- ๐งโ๐ณ Chefs: Prepare and cook food in restaurants.
- ๐ซ Servers: Take orders and serve food to customers.
- ๐ Delivery Drivers: Deliver food to customers' homes.
๐ ๏ธ Maintenance Services
- ๐ช Plumbers: Install and repair water pipes and fixtures.
- ๐ก Electricians: Install and repair electrical systems.
- ๐งน Janitors: Clean and maintain buildings.
